Durban actor debuts Dream Boy at 2012 National Arts Festival Grahamstown.

Stallone Santino (20) makes his way to perform at the National Arts Festival in Grahamstown in June 2012.

Dream Boy; a one man show encompassing an intriguing storyline of a teenage boy who has a dream of being an actor. Stallone is an 18 year old matric graduate, passionate about studying drama, but has to face the wrath of his mother’s opposing view. In dispute, he is left with an ultimatum. In a matter of haste, the over-eager teen chooses in his favor, in an attempt to overcome the challenges faced at home, yet most importantly, to fulfill his passion of becoming an actor. An array of obstacles are encountered by the protagonist and is compelled to the place of choice, yet again. A thrilling twist to in the narrative that will leave the audience surprised and wondering.

Produced by DarNak Media with Darrel Nakul, Directed, written and performed by Stallone Santino, the riveting play takes the audience on
a journey of struggle, melancholy and anticipation. A great sense of stereotypical South African characters are presented, incorporating vernacular languages, diverse accents, along with an interesting sense of humor that will have the audience entertained till the very end. The play incorporates elements of poetry, narratives, dance and song that is structured to enhance the theatre experience and suit a variety of audience members.

Dream Boy, inspired by true events will take place at the National Arts Festival from the 28-30 June 2012. With a total of 5 performances spread across the weekend, the public can enjoy this one hander which is suitable for the whole family.
